BGSU vs. CCAD

Both Bowling Green State University-Main Campus and Columbus College of Art and Design are 4 years schools located in Ohio. The following statements compare Bowling Green State University-Main Campus and Columbus College of Art and Design with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• CCAD's tuition ($39,650) is more expensive than BGSU ($22,070).
  • BGSU's acceptance rate (78.66%) is lower than CCAD (90.98%).
  • CCAD has higher yield (32.15%) than BGSU (21.40%).
  •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,100.
  • CCAD's students to faculty ratio (10 to 1) is lower than BGSU (17 to 1).
  • BGSU (16,920 students) is larger than CCAD (972 students) with more enrolled students.
  • CCAD ($22,630) has higher amount of financial aid than BGSU ($8,761).
  • BGSU's graduation rate (61%) is higher than CCAD (59%).
